This is just a suggestion, and I'm not sure if it applies to you but VSO is an organization that takes volunteers, and as far as I know you're not required (please correct me if I'm wrong on this someone?) to raise a huge amount of money for it. They recruit professionals in various fields to help developments in (mainly third world) countries. It's similiary to the Peace Corps. I'm planning on joining VSO Canada once I get my Teaching degree and two years of experience. The placements are for 2 yrs though - they help defer loans, they pay for virtually all of your expenses and help you get back on your feet when you go back home, you're well taken care of there. It might be worth looking into - just a suggestion if you're interested at all; another option for you just in case. You didn't mention your nationality in your post, but they operate out of Canada, the UK, and I think the Netherlands (?) - they also take US volunteers.
